Jazz at St. Patrick’s Day dinner March 17
The Lamb of God Lutheran Church in Haines City is sponsoring a St. Patrick’s Day dinner and concert the afternoon and early evening of March 17. The event is open to the public and will be held at the church, which is located across from the U.S. Post Office at the intersection of State Road 544 and State Road 17.
John Skillman and his New Orleans Night Hawks will perform a broad array of traditional jazz including Dixieland, swing and blues. Their repertoire will include hymns and Irish music. The band is comprised of Skillman on clarinet and vocals, Mike Evans on banjo and vocals, Bob Hudgins on bass, Stan Mulder on drums, and vocalist Diana Skillman. The Night Hawks often draw large and enthusiastic crowds at local venues. Limited seating is available for a corned beef, cabbage and potatoes dinner that will include homemade desserts and non-alcoholic beverages.
